Curtain

1. rail or Roman rod?

Curtains can be hung in two ways, one on a rail and the other on a Roman pole - these are the only two ways.

If you have not yet begun to decorate, it is recommended to choose the track. It turns out that there are two reasons:One is that the top of the track fabric design curtain is better sealed, and later on, it will be much better than the Roman rod in terms of light blocking, warmth and sound insulation. And from the appearance of the track, because the track is hidden installation method, the overall sense is stronger, and can be integrated with the wall. Secondly, the smart home is becoming more and more popular, can automatically open and close the smart curtains must be used with the track. The so-called "smart curtains" is actually a networked motor. All track curtains can be directly equipped with this motor.

However, the track must be installed in conjunction with the hard furnishings, the curtain boxes must be made in advance, and the center of the entire room must be shifted. If you have already missed the renovation, you will have to choose a Roman Shade Curtain rod. For the curtain store, the cost of both the Roman rod and the track is about the same. For users, choosing a track requires an extra curtain box, which costs slightly more than a Roman rod.

2. Single layer or double layer?

Single-layer curtains, that is, only one layer of fabric curtains. Double-layer curtains, that is, there is a layer of tulle curtains behind the curtains. Whether it's a rail or a Roman rod, you can choose either double or single layer curtains.

So which one do you choose? Let's look at the needs first:Users with very low floors need privacy during the day. Rooms exposed to the sun also need to reduce the intensity of the sun at night. In both cases, screen curtains are very necessary.

Second look at the effect: In addition to the use of gauze, curtains have a certain decorative effect. If the decorative style requires the appearance of a layer of gauze to decorate, and this room does have a decorative value (such as the living room) , you can install a layer of gauze curtains.

Without either of these, it is not recommended to install a voile curtain. The use rate of the screen curtain is extremely low, often used only a few times a year, but also take up space for nothing.

3. Is the shading rate really that important?

In fact, the shading rate of curtains is really important, but not the higher the shading rate, the better. Shading rate by the density of the curtains, thickness and other factors to determine, we only need to know, the higher the shading rate, the more opaque the curtains will be enough.

The shading rate of curtains is 20% ~ 95%, of which the shading rate of 80% or more is called "full shade" curtains, the rest is called "half shade" curtains. When choosing, it is recommended to choose full blackout curtains for the bedroom, and half blackout curtains for the living room, study and other public areas.

For those who do not sleep well, the shading rate of curtains can be increased appropriately. In addition to darkening the room, curtains with high shading rate can also enhance the sealing of the room, and the soundproofing and acoustic insulation will also be improved. So if you happen to want to change the environment in a way to improve the quality of sleep, you can choose curtains with more than 90% shading.

Normal people, especially teenagers, are not recommended to choose curtains with too much shading. A shade of 90% or more can make a room look like late night, even in broad daylight. A little thought shows that sleeping in this room is very unfriendly to one's biological clock. The healthiest way is to let the early morning sunlight wake us up - so opt for 80% or more shading.

Living room study and other rooms, the main research purpose of using smart curtains is that in fact we are not blackout, but to protect personal privacy. Lights on in the room at night, outside to see inside will be very with clarity. Choosing curtains with a blackout rate of 60% or more is enough to ensure this privacy. With this type of blackout, you can see that the lights are on in the room from the outside, but you can't see the people in the room.
